Elasticity (economics)
Elasticity measures how one economic variable responds to another.
Cross_elasticity_of_demand_complements.svg : Wykis derivative work: Mcsenia819 ( · Public domain
Elasticity in economics measures the responsiveness of one economic variable to a change in another. It is a key concept in neoclassical economic theory, used to understand phenomena such as the incidence of indirect taxation, the theory of the firm, distribution of wealth, and consumer choice. Elasticity is quantified as the ratio of the percentage change in one variable to the percentage change in another causative variable, holding all other conditions constant.

Mathematical Foundation and Classification
At its core, elasticity is defined as the ratio of the percentage change in one variable to the percentage change in another causally related variable, holding all other conditions constant. Formally, the elasticity of x with respect to y equals the fractional change in x divided by the fractional change in y. When changes become infinitesimally small, this expression simplifies to the partial derivative of x with respect to y, multiplied by y over x. Because it is constructed from percentage changes, elasticity is a unitless ratio, independent of the particular units used to measure the quantities involved. A variable whose absolute elasticity exceeds one is classified as elastic, responding more than proportionally to shifts in the driving variable. When the absolute value equals one, the response is exactly proportional, termed unit elastic. Below one, the variable is inelastic, changing less than proportionally. Crucially, a single variable can exhibit different elasticity values at different starting points, meaning the same good might be elastic at low prices yet inelastic at higher ones.
Applications Across Economic Theory
Elasticity permeates virtually every branch of economic analysis. Within neoclassical theory, it serves as a key mechanism for understanding the incidence of indirect taxation, marginal concepts in firm theory, the distribution of wealth, and the classification of goods in consumer choice theory. It is equally vital when discussing welfare distribution, particularly in calculating consumer surplus, producer surplus, and government surplus. The concept manifests in numerous distinct indicators: price elasticity of demand, price elasticity of supply, income elasticity of demand, elasticity of substitution between factors of production, cross-price elasticity of demand, and elasticity of intertemporal substitution. In microeconomics, elasticity and slope are intimately connected; analyzing the linear slope of a demand or supply curve, or the tangent at a particular point, reveals the elasticity at that location. A steeper tangent corresponds to smaller elasticity, while a flatter one indicates higher elasticity, giving analysts a geometric lens through which to interpret responsiveness.
Empirical Measurement and Practical Interpretation
In empirical research, elasticity takes on a particularly elegant form: it is estimated as the coefficient in a linear regression where both the dependent and independent variables are expressed in natural logarithms. This log-log specification is what makes elasticity so popular among empiricists, since the resulting coefficient is independent of units, greatly simplifying data analysis across different markets, currencies, and scales. A practical illustration helps clarify the concept: if the price elasticity of demand for a good is negative two, then a ten percent increase in price will cause the quantity demanded to fall by twenty percent. This straightforward interpretation allows policymakers and business strategists to forecast behavioral responses without needing to track specific units. Whether analyzing how suppliers adjust output at different price levels or how consumers shift between substitutes, the elasticity framework provides a universal language for measuring economic responsiveness.
